As a solar eclipse graced the skies of the United States, Taylor Swift delighted fans with a tantalizing peek into what could be potential lyrics from her upcoming album, ‘The Tortured Poets Department.’ The music sensation shared an intriguing snippet on her Instagram Story, featuring a typewriter rhythmically imprinting the words, “Crowd goes wild at her fingertips, half moonshine, full eclipse,” accompanied by a pre-order link.
Swift’s enigmatic post set social media abuzz as viewers ventured outdoors to witness the celestial phenomenon of the moon obscuring the sun. Known for her interactive approach with fans, Swift’s cryptic clues align with her signature style of engagement. The monochromatic video snippet resonates with the subdued theme expected from her 11th studio album, scheduled for release on April 19.
The announcement of ‘The Tortured Poets Department’ took center stage during the 2024 Grammys when Swift, upon accepting the award for Best Pop Vocal Album for ‘Midnights,’ revealed the album’s surprise release date. “I want to say thank you to the fans by telling you a secret that I’ve been keeping from you for the last two years, which is that my brand new album comes out on April 19. It’s called ‘The Tortured Poets Department.’ I’m gonna go and post the cover. Right now, backstage. Thank you,” Swift announced to a thrilled audience.
The significance of April 19 resonates with Swift’s affinity for the number 13, a recurring motif in her life and career. She shared in a 2009 interview with Jay Leno about the peculiar connection to the number: “I was born on the 13th. I turned 13 on Friday the 13th. My first album went gold in 13 weeks. Also, my first song that ever went Number One, it had a 13-second intro, and I didn’t do it on purpose,” she revealed.
Since the Grammy revelation, Swift has unveiled the album’s tracklist on February 5, featuring collaborations with notable artists such as Post Malone and Florence + The Machine. ‘The Tortured Poets Department’ boasts 17 tracks, with a bonus inclusion titled “The Manuscript.”
To complement the album’s launch, SiriusXM has introduced Channel 13 (Taylor’s Version), a dedicated station airing Swift’s music alongside fan narratives until May 7. The channel will spotlight her full album on its release date and throughout the subsequent weekend.
